Abstract
Double inlet left ventricle (DILV) is a rare congenital cardiac malformation that is defined as an anomaly with univentricular atrioventricular (AV) connection, and single ventricular morphology. This variation can be associated with the inlet and outlet cardiac abnormalities. In the current report, we present a case of Holms heart, as a rare variant of double-inlet left ventricle.
